🌿 Cultivation & Care Information
-
Botanical Name: Citrus iyo
-
Common Name / Synonym: Iyokan Orange / Anadokan / Japanese Sweet Mandarin / Rutaceae Fruit Crop
-
Plant Type: Tropical and subtropical evergreen fruit tree / perennial
-
Sun Requirements: Full sun (Prefers 6 to 8 hours of direct, unobstructed sunlight daily to encourage optimal flowering, fruit set, and sweet juice development).
-
Soil / Medium: Thrives in a rich, loamy, highly well-draining soil mix amended with organic compost and perlite to maintain moisture while preventing waterlogged roots.
-
Watering: Keep the soil consistently moist but never soggy during the active growing season. Allow the top inch of soil to dry out slightly between waterings, reducing frequency during cooler winter months.
-
Growth Habit: An upright, vigorous evergreen fruit tree featuring glossy dark green foliage, highly fragrant white citrus blossoms, and clusters of smooth, plump orange mandarin fruits.
-
Temperature: Thrives in warm tropical, subtropical, and Mediterranean climates (Ideal temperature range: 15°C to 30°C / 59°F to 86°F). Protect from harsh frost and freezing winter conditions.
🌱 Pro Growing Tip: To achieve the best germination and seedling establishment success, clean and soak your Iyokan Orange seeds in lukewarm water for 24 hours before planting them in a warm, well-draining seed-starting mix under bright, indirect light!
